<?xml version="1.0" encoding="UTF-8"?>
<GenerateModel x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ance" xsi:noNamespaceSchemaLocation="generateMetaModel_Module.xsd">
<PythonExport
Father="PyObjectBase"
Name="AxisPy"
Twin="Axis"
TwinPointer="Axis"
Include="Base/Axis.h"
FatherInclude="Base/PyObjectBase.h"
Namespace="Base"
Constructor="true"
Delete="true"
FatherNamespace="Base">
<Documentation>
<Author Licence="LGPL" Name="Juergen Riegel" EMail="FreeCAD@juergen-riegel.net" />
<UserDocu>Base.Axis class.
An Axis defines a direction and a position (base) in 3D space.
The following constructors are supported:
Axis()
Empty constructor.
Axis(axis)
Copy constructor.
axis : Base.Axis
Axis(base, direction)
Define from a position and a direction.
base : Base.Vector
direction : Base.Vector</UserDocu>
<DeveloperDocu>Axis</DeveloperDocu>
</Documentation>
<Methode Name="copy">>
<Documentation>
<UserDocu>copy() -> Base.Axis
Returns a copy of this Axis.</UserDocu>
</Documentation>
</Methode>
<Methode Name="move">
<Documentation>
<UserDocu>move(vector) -> None
Move the axis base along the given vector.
vector : Base.Vector
Vector by which to move the axis.</UserDocu>
</Documentation>
</Methode>
<Methode Name="multiply">
<Documentation>
<UserDocu>multiply(placement) -> Base.Axis
Multiply this axis by a placement.
placement : Base.Placement
Placement by which to multiply the axis.</UserDocu>
</Documentation>
</Methode>
<Methode Name="reversed">
<Documentation>
<UserDocu>reversed() -> Base.Axis
Compute the reversed axis. This returns a new Base.Axis with
the original direction reversed.</UserDocu>
</Documentation>
</Methode>
<Attribute Name="Base" ReadOnly="false">
<Documentation>
<UserDocu>Base position vector of the Axis.</UserDocu>
</Documentation>
<Parameter Name="Base" Type="Object" />
</Attribute>
<Attribute Name="Direction" ReadOnly="false">
<Documentation>
<UserDocu>Direction vector of the Axis.</UserDocu>
</Documentation>
<Parameter Name="Direction" Type="Object" />
</Attribute>
</PythonExport>
</GenerateModel>
